About a year ago....had ashtray out and waiting in drive-thru line at Taco bell, pushed ashtray in and ...poof...bye-bye radio.

How do I get the face plate off so I can pull radio out and look at wiring?

no need for any special tool to remove the factory radio. Don't waste your money, no matter how little it is. All you need is and old fashioned wire hanger from your closet. Cut 4 pieces approx. 4 inches long. stick the pieces into the 4 holes on you radio and spread them apart slightly while pulling out towards you. Your radio will come right out. All you are doing is putting pressure on 4 the clips that hold the radio in. If it seems to stick on on side, simply put a little more pressure. Just remember, you want to push the clips in towards the radio, so push the 4 hanger pieces out away from the radio.
